About International Center on Small Hydro Power

The International Center on Small Hydro Power (ICSHP) is a public and non-profit institution directly under the auspices of United Nations Industrial and Development Organization (UNIDO), China’s Ministry of Water Resources and Ministry of Commerce. ICSHP serves as the headquarters of the International Network on Small Hydro Power (INSHP), which is an international organization with more than 400 members from 78 countries.

 

About Global Environment Facility

The Global Environment Facility (GEF) was established on the eve of the 1992 Rio Earth Summit, to help tackle our planet’s most pressing environmental problems. Since then, the GEF has provided $14.5 billion in grants and mobilized $75.4 billion in additional financing for almost 4,000 projects. The GEF has become an international partnership of 183 countries, international institutions, civil society organizations, and private sector to address global environmental issues.

 

GEF 6 Project: Upgrading of China SHP Capacity Project

The Project is situated at the heart of the water-energy nexus and aims at promoting innovation, technology transfer, and supportive policies and strategies in SHP. It will focus on green and safe Small Hydro Power (SHP) upgrading/refurbishment in China. The main objective is to support the Ministry of Water Resources to introduce new measures to SHP upgrading in China, to ensure SHP has less of an environmental impact and that safe production and management processes are introduced at the same time as reducing GHG emissions.

 

The total project implementation duration is about 5 years. In June 2016, the project was approved by GEF, and its implementation officially started in July 2017. The Project Management Unit (PMU) is based in ICSHP, which is in charge of the coordination of the project implementation.
